← All openingsRead Ravi's bio →
Tech · Dubai · Senior · Retained
Senior Data Engineer — Customer & Pricing
GCC-headquartered B2B logistics scale-up (Series B, US$80M raised)
430 staff · 22-person data org reporting to the CTO
Compensation band
AED 380k – 520k base annual
Bonus
15% target bonus
Equity
Phantom-share programme, 4-year vest
Posted
1 April 2026
The brief
Owns the canonical customer-and-pricing data model end-to-end. Sits in the platform sub-team within the data org. The role exists because pricing decisions are currently being made on six conflicting daily extracts and the COO has lost patience.
Scope of the role
- · Owns the customer + pricing dimensional model in the warehouse (Snowflake on AWS).
- · Builds and runs the dbt project that materialises the model.
- · Pairs with the analytics engineering team on consumer-facing pricing dashboards.
- · Mentors two mid-level data engineers without managing them formally.
Must-haves
- · Five years building production data pipelines, two of those with primary ownership of a domain model.
- · dbt at production-scale (multiple environments, exposures, tests).
- · Snowflake or BigQuery (or comparable cloud warehouse) at production scale.
- · Python or SQL fluency to write reusable transformations and tests.
Nice-to-haves
- · Logistics or marketplace pricing-model experience.
- · Experience replacing legacy Tableau/Looker estates with metric-layer-first pipelines.
- · Comfort working with finance teams on contribution-margin reporting.
Process
- 45-min initial call with Ravi.
- Two-hour technical conversation with the Head of Data + a senior analytics engineer.
- Take-home pricing-model exercise (4 hours, 3-day window).
- Final on-site: COO + CFO + senior partner from the analytics team.
- Offer.
Consultant on the search
Ravi Iyer
Senior Consultant, Tech
GCC engineering, data, and product. Former in-house tech recruiter at Talabat through the Delivery-Hero acquisition cycle.
Email: ravi.iyer@calibertalent.com
Apply
Send your CV and a one-paragraph note on why this brief fits. The consultant on the role will reply personally inside 5 working days.